Tirana: frequently asked questions
When is the best time to visit Tirana?
Spring and autumn for mild city-walking weather. In general, Tirana is best from May to October.
How many days do you need in Tirana?
Plan for 2 to 3 days to see Tirana properly. It pairs well with nearby spots for a longer trip.
